Choose an impressive cake
Kids birthday parties and cake go hand in hand, and we all have fond memories of our childhood birthdays of tucking into the sweet stuff. One way you can make the party stand out is by creating an incredible cake, something memorable and that will stand out in the children’s minds. Paying a professional can be expensive, so it’s well worth having a go yourself. Follow a tutorial from Pinterest and choose something that looks great but you can see is within your skill set. To ensure the finished product comes out tasting great, if you don’t bake often then take a shortcut and used boxed cake mix or even buy some plain sponges. From there you can cut and shape them, cover them with fondant and decorate however you’d like.
Go with a theme
Themes help to make birthdays extra fun and memorable. It could be anything from superheroes to princesses, a certain type of tv show, a book or something else entirely. From there you can tailor the decorations, activities and even the food to suit! Ask guests to come in fancy dress which is always a lot of fun for kids- or you could hire a face painter so that everyone can be part of the theme. If for example you were hosting an underwater theme, you could make ‘mermaid’ cupcakes with iridescent icing, blue balloons and streamers to give an under the sea appearance and have a face painter paint fish or sea creatures onto the kids faces. Look into photo booth hire or consider hiring a photographer to capture the best pictures of the day- and your creations!
Hire a bouncy castle
A bouncy castle is ultimate fun as a child, and can add a whole other level of excitement to a birthday party. You can hire them relatively cheaply for a day or an entire weekend, and you know that’s all your children’s guests will be talking about in school the next day! If you don’t want to have to come up with lots of games and activities to keep kids occupied at the party then a bouncy castle is a good choice as it will keep them busy all day. You could go a step further and set up a ball pit and/ or a paddling pool as well.
